Did you think that the JT Special Super RuckusRaiser could only do the Mexican hat dance down Puerto Vallarta way? No sir, the JT Special can do the hula too! It did it well enough to land this Hawaiian ahi!
It’s uncommon to boat an ahi in February since the prime season for them is during the summer but the JT enticed this one to bite on the troll. And once it bit, like Capt. Fred says – squish, nothing but hook! And a circle hook to boot, proving, to me at least, that Capt. Fred knows whereof he speaks in that regard as well. Note the perfect hook placement in the close-up shot.
